ABSTRACT:
The device finds application, particularly, in the instrument panels of aircraft, where it comprises: three liquid crystal optical valves, controlled by three electrical signals respectively representing a red image, a green image and a blue image. Two holographic mirrors are utilized, as is a standard mirror and two dichroic strips to illuminate the three valves respectively by three beams, colored red, green and blue, from a single source of white light, while at the same time reducing the space occupied by the optical elements needed to guide the three beams to the minimum. A dichroic cube then superimposes the three beams coming respectively from the three valves and an optical system to form a trichromatic image on a diffusing screen. The optical system collimates the rays coming from the image formed on the diffusing screen to enable an observer to see an image collimated at long distance, with a wide field.
